Real-time Threat Detection Delivers 99.95% Uptime in 2024 While Preventing Fraud Across Connected Devices

Semtech Corporation, a leading provider of high-performance semiconductor, Internet of Things (IoT) systems and cloud connectivity service solutions, has achieved 99.95% network uptime in 2024 through its enhanced global mobile network infrastructure.

This milestone underscores the company’s commitment to securing mission-critical IoT deployments worldwide.

As a full Mobile Virtual Network Operator (MVNO), Semtech’s AirVantage® Smart Connectivity service leverages artificial intelligence (AI) to enhance security, optimize network performance and improve customer experience. These tools are integrated into Semtech’s Global Network Operations Center (GNOC), which provides 24/7 monitoring and proactive security management.

Real Time Threat Detection and Prevention

The GNOC’s advanced monitoring system is AI-enabled to continuously analyze network activity for anomalies, identifying potential security breaches before they impact operations. In recent deployments, the system detected and prevented unauthorized SIM usage across multiple regions, protecting customers from fraudulent charges and service disruptions.

Intelligent Network Optimization

Automated diagnostics intelligently identify connectivity issues, including excessive data consumption caused by customer’s software bugs. This proactive approach has already helped multiple enterprise customers avoid costly overages and maintain optimal performance.

Enhanced Customer Support

The platform’s intelligent customer support system automates case prioritization and data retrieval, significantly reducing Mean Time to Resolution (MTTR) for technical issues. Support tickets are pre-populated with relevant customer data, enabling faster, more effective problem resolution.
